| Sumario: | In the following article I will take an approach to the history of recent Villamariense theater. Considering the insufficient coverage of the local theater as an object of study, the lack of conditions for safeguarding and archiving theatrical memories and the conditions of possibility to enter the field from different ways, I will take as a corpus the book Mutis por Foro by Virginia Ventura (2022). For this, I will describe some problems linked to the local and regional historiography of the city of Villa María with the objective of producing a contextualization of the geo-imaginary nodes of the city by those who produce theater, in analytical contrast to Villa María as a city-region projected from state institutions.
